import pandas as pd
import numpy as np
读取数据
g1=pd.read_csv(r"F:\_test.csv")
g1
查看表的行列信息,有多少行,多少列
g1.shape
查看表的内存信息
g1.info(memory_usage="deep")
查看不同内类型所占用的内存空间大小
for dtype in ["float64","int64","object"]:
selected_type=g1.select_dtypes(include=[dtype])
mean_usage_b=selected_type.memory_usage(deep=True)
mean_usage_mb=mean_usage_b/1024**2
print("平均占用内存:",dtype,mean_usage_mb)
定义一个函数,来判定输入的数据大小
def mem_usage(pandas_obj